De Gele Kanarie

De Gele Kanarie
The beer and food paradise De Gele Kanarie is on the corner of the Goudsesingel and the Mariniersweg. The interior of the bar may remind you of the Bokaal and Weena cafés, also owned by Ron de Jong and Dave Heijnen. De Gele Kanarie serves lunch, dinner and various types of beer, wine and mixed drinks. They also have their own brewed beer on tap: DGK or De Gele Kanarie (Yellow Canary).

Supermercado

Supermercado

At the corner of the Witte de Withstraat, you can find a bar and restaurant Supermercado. This cosy place reminds of a bubbling South-American cantina. Young families, professionals and groups of friends — everyone is welcome at Supermercado, for a good coffee, late lunch or early dinner. You can eat your heart out with one of the many meat, fish or vegetarian dishes that are prepared in a truly Latin American way on the charcoal grill. Also, you will of course find Mexican tacos and tortilla chips on the menu. Order a cerveza or tequila as a side and your evening is complete.
